covert 02665 ## chephes {khay'- fes} ; from 02664 ; something {covert} , i . e . a trick : -- search .

covert 03858 ## lahat {lah'- hat} ; from 03857 ; a blaze ; also (from the idea of enwrapping) magic (as {covert}) : -- flaming , enchantment .

covert 03911 ## l@ta'ah {let-aw-aw'} ; from an unused root meaning to hide ; a kind of lizard (from its {covert} habits) : -- lizard .

covert 04329 ## meycak {may-sawk'} ; from 05526 ; a portico (as covered) : -- {covert} .

covert 04563 ## mictowr {mis-tore'} ; from 05641 ; a refuge : -- {covert} .

covert 04565 ## mictar {mis-tawr'} ; from 05641 ; properly , a concealer , i . e . a {covert} : -- secret (- ly , place) .

covert 04679 ## m@tsad {mets-ad'} ; or m@tsad {mets-awd'} ; or (feminine) m@tsadah {mets-aw-daw'} ; from 06679 ; a fastness (as a {covert} of ambush) : -- castle , fort , (strong) hold , munition .

covert 05520 ## cok {soke} ; from 05526 ; a hut (as of entwined boughs) ; also a lair : -- {covert} , den , pavilion , tabernacle .

covert 05521 ## cukkah {sook-kaw'} ; fem of 05520 ; a hut or lair : -- booth , cottage , {covert} , pavilion , tabernacle , tent .

covert 05643 ## cether {say'- ther} ; or (feminine) cithrah (Deut . 32 : 38) , {sith-raw'} ; from 05641 ; a cover (in a good or a bad , a literal or a figurative sense) : -- backbiting , covering , {covert} , X disguise [-th ] , hiding place , privily , protection , secret (- ly , place) .

covertly 00898 ## bagad {baw-gad'} ; a primitive root ; to cover (with a garment) ; figuratively , to act {covertly} ; by implication , to pillage : -- deal deceitfully (treacherously , unfaithfully) , offend , transgress (- or) , (depart) , treacherous (dealer ,-ly , man) , unfaithful (- ly , man) , X very .

covertly 02644 ## chapha'{khaw-faw'} ; an orthographical variation of 02645 ; properly , to cover , i . e . (in a sinister sense) to act {covertly} : -- do secretly .

covertly 03909 ## lat {lawt} ; a form of 03814 or else participle from 03874 ; properly , covered , i . e . secret ; by implication , incantation ; also secrecy or (adverb) {covertly} : -- enchantment , privily , secretly , softly .

covertly 04603 ## ma` al {maw-al'} ; a primitive root ; properly , to cover up ; used only figuratively , to act {covertly} , i . e . treacherously : -- transgress , (commit , do a) trespass (- ing) .

covertly 06049 ## ` anan {aw-nan'} ; a primitive root ; to cover ; used only as a denominative from 06051 , to cloud over ; figuratively , to act {covertly} , i . e . practise magic : -- X bring , enchanter , Meonemin , observe (- r of) times , soothsayer , sorcerer .

covertly 5227 - hupenantios {hoop-en-an-tee'-os}; from 5259 and 1727; under ({covertly}) contrary to, i.e. opposed or (as noun) an opponent: -- adversary, against.

covertly 5259 - hupo {hoop-o'}; a primary preposition; under, i.e. (with the genitive case) of place (beneath), or with verbs (the agency or means, through); (with the accusative case) of place (whither [underneath] or where [below] or time (when [at]): -- among, by, from, in, of, under, with. In comp. it retains the same general applications, especially of inferior position or condition, and specifically, {covertly} or moderately.
